引言
在当今的工业自动化和信息技术领域,设备的稳定运行至关重要。然而,随着设备复杂性的增加,故障诊断的难度也在不断提升。可解释性故障诊断作为一种新兴的技术,旨在通过提高故障诊断的透明度和可理解性,帮助运维人员快速、准确地识别问题根源,从而提升设备运维效率。本文将深入探讨可解释性故障诊断的原理、方法及其在实际应用中的优势。
可解释性故障诊断概述
定义
可解释性故障诊断(Explainable Fault Diagnosis,简称EFD)是指通过分析设备运行数据,结合专家知识和机器学习算法,对故障原因进行解释和预测的一种技术。它强调故障诊断过程的透明性和可理解性,使得运维人员能够理解诊断结果,从而提高故障处理的效率和准确性。
目标
可解释性故障诊断的主要目标包括:
- 准确识别故障:通过分析设备运行数据,准确识别设备是否存在故障。
- 精准定位故障根源:分析故障产生的原因,定位故障的具体位置。
- 解释诊断结果:提供故障原因的解释,帮助运维人员理解诊断过程。
可解释性故障诊断方法
数据预处理
数据预处理是可解释性故障诊断的基础,主要包括以下步骤:
- 数据清洗:去除异常值和噪声,提高数据质量。
- 特征提取:从原始数据中提取与故障相关的特征。
- 数据标准化:将不同量纲的数据进行标准化处理,便于后续分析。
故障检测
故障检测是可解释性故障诊断的核心环节,主要包括以下方法:
- 基于阈值的方法:通过设定阈值,判断设备运行状态是否正常。
- 基于模型的方法:利用机器学习算法建立故障检测模型,对设备运行状态进行预测。
故障定位
故障定位是可解释性故障诊断的关键环节,主要包括以下方法:
- 基于故障树的方法:通过构建故障树,分析故障传播路径,定位故障根源。
- 基于数据关联的方法:利用数据关联规则,分析故障数据之间的关联关系,定位故障根源。
故障解释
故障解释是可解释性故障诊断的重要环节,主要包括以下方法:
- 可视化方法:通过可视化工具展示故障数据和分析结果,帮助运维人员理解诊断过程。
- 解释性模型:利用可解释性机器学习算法,提供故障原因的解释。
可解释性故障诊断在实际应用中的优势
提高诊断效率
可解释性故障诊断通过提高故障诊断的透明度和可理解性,使得运维人员能够快速定位故障根源,从而提高诊断效率。
降低误诊率
可解释性故障诊断通过分析故障数据,结合专家知识,降低误诊率,提高诊断准确性。
促进知识积累
可解释性故障诊断将故障诊断过程和结果进行解释,有助于运维人员积累故障处理经验,促进知识积累。
提升设备可靠性
通过可解释性故障诊断,运维人员能够及时发现并处理故障,从而提高设备的可靠性。
结论
可解释性故障诊断作为一种新兴的技术,在提高设备运维效率、降低故障率等方面具有显著优势。随着技术的不断发展,可解释性故障诊断将在工业自动化和信息技术领域发挥越来越重要的作用。
